Once competitors and Olympic teammates, now friends and podcast partners, Des Linden and Kara Goucher share their hot takes about all things running with a little bit of life-stuff sprinkled in too. Come for the insights on running and stay for the inspiration from two legends in the sport. No filter needed. This podcast is presented by Brooks Running.2023 Running & Jogging

  • 3.23. The Gossip Episode
    Aug 19 2025

    Gossip? Facts? Real news? This episode has a little bit of all 3 in a back-and-forth dynamic that will leave you laughing and loving it.

    Des and Kara start with an update on their girls trip to Cincinnati to visit their friend @runningcb. There was baseball and tennis and so much walking involved that Kara is still sore today. There were also shenanigans with dog Miles and beer challenges for Des and shared bedrooms. It's safe to say that Des and Kara have entered into a new level of friendship with this trip (and that Crouton might be jealous).

    Then, they turn to all of the running chatter from this past week including a comeback race for Keely, WR attempt for Faith, hope for Yared, and of course, the latest "transparency" from Michael Johnson and Grand Slam Track. They talk doping offenses from Fred Kerley and collegiate Parvej Khan, remind the pros how easy it is to use the whereabouts system, and wonder when more rigorous testing will come to the collegiate and high school level. With NIL expanding, are high schoolers and their parents ready for testers to watch them pee in a cup?!

    Finally, they end with an unhinged Lagoon Sleep top 5 (err... 4?).

  • 3.22. The US Champs Recap Episode
    Aug 12 2025

    We know you want US Champs reactions, but this episode starts with the real post-mortem you've been waiting for... the redux on the Hot Ones challenge where Kara and Des go full TMI on you. They tell you all about the spicy aftermath of last week's episode, and Des shares that she has been going back for more.

    Then after quick life updates, they get into in-depth recaps of every event 800m+ at the US Champs. There are almost too many storylines to cover from surprises in the distance events to some sprint drama both on and off the track. There was so much good stuff that it took a full 95 minutes to recap. We can't wait for Tokyo... can you?!

  • 3.21. Des & Kara Meet the Hot Ones Challenge
    Aug 5 2025

    We are mixing it up with this episode, and let's just say that things get a little bit spicy!

    If you haven't subscribed to our YouTube channel yet, then now is the time b/c you will want to watch this one there for sure.

    In this episode, I (editor Chris) join as host to take Des and Kara through the Hot Ones challenge, using the hot sauce line-up from Season 27 of the show. Hot Ones is the show with hot questions and even hotter wings, but since we recorded this in Austin, we swapped in smoked brisket for hot wings, with all of the same sauces from the show.

    To start, we cover fun running questions and then get into deeper life stuff as the bites getting hotter. Des and Kara hang in there pretty well until brisket bite #8, when things drastically fall off the rails as we hit the infamous "Da Bomb" sauce. Des starts sweating dramatically from the sides of her nose, and suddenly Kara can't form a coherent sentence.

    In addition to the hilarious spectacle of it, you learn some fun stuff along the way including their post-long-run food of choice, their alt Olympic sport from another life, some very questionable road-trip hygiene choices, and how they remain authentic in the public eye (plus so much more).

    How will these two Olympians handle the challenge?!? Tune in to find out!
